Lovely Hoffman is an American recording artist, music theatre performer, record producer, musician, and actress. She received notable recognition in 2007 when her debut single, "Can't Wait" peaked #10 on the urban college radio charts. In 2010, Lovely established herself in the theatre arts world when she was cast to co-star alongside Broadway star Marissa Perry in a production of Hairspray the musical, which was directed by Todd Michel Smith and Judine Somerville both cast members of the original Broadway production. Lovely has also performed and shared the stage with other notable R&B artists including Grammy Award winning singer and songwriter Ne-Yo and multi-platinum recording artist and producer T-Pain.
